Quick and Delicious Easy Potsticker Soup

A fast and comforting one-pot soup made with frozen potstickers simmered in a savory garlic-ginger broth.
Prep Time 5 minutes
Cook Time 20 minutes
Total Time 25 minutes
Servings: 4 bowls
Course: Main, Soup
Cuisine: Asian-Inspired
Calories: 320

Ingredients
  

  • 1 tbsp sesame oil
  • 3 cloves garlic minced
  • 1 tbsp fresh ginger grated
  • 6 cups chicken or vegetable broth
  • 2 tbsp soy sauce
  • 16 oz frozen potstickers
  • 2 cups bok choy chopped
  • 2 tbsp green onions sliced

Equipment

  • Large pot or Dutch oven
  • Wooden spoon
  • Ladle

Method
 

  1. Heat sesame oil in a large pot over medium heat.
  2. Add garlic and ginger; sauté until fragrant.
  3. Pour in broth and soy sauce; bring to a boil.
  4. Add frozen potstickers and simmer until cooked through.
  5. Add bok choy and cook until just tender.
  6. Garnish with green onions and serve hot.
